Transaction 20598f52315843d487285af946cbfdef580e6ba95c4f1b679f4a6c4783069d12
2 Input
2 Outputs
- 20598f52315843d487285af946cbfdef580e6ba95c4f1b679f4a6c4783069d12:0
- 20598f52315843d487285af946cbfdef580e6ba95c4f1b679f4a6c4783069d12:1
value 669795
address 1ShbdkUC3Ad1iqWw6fLsFS9F2APeB6fTZ
value 31956
address 17Z7PyrdP6dggcYDF7yjhhhnqmVNc75g4S